在php 中==和=的区别

来源:百度知道 编辑:UC知道 时间:2024/04/29 07:38:19
在php 中==和=的区别

二楼三楼位都为正解,那么我就给你写几个例子吧
1.==是等于的意思,用于逻辑判断比如 :
if($num == 13){
$a = $b;
}else{
$a = $c;
}

2.=是将右边的值赋给左边的变量 ,如:

$str = '这是字符串变量';
$arr = array(1,2,3);//这是一个数组
$obj = new class; //这是一个对象

一般的..=是赋值操作符.而==是判断是否相等的操作符,对应的不相等一般是!=

=是表示把等号左边的值赋值给等号右边的表达式,
==是表示等号左边和右边相等的操作符,一般用于if等条件语句当中

==是用来比较是否相等
=是将右边的值赋给左边的变量